在当今这个移动设备无处不在的时代,跨平台表单设计已经成为网站和应用程序开发中不可或缺的一环。一个设计精良、易于使用的表单,能够提升用户体验,增加用户粘性。本文将为你详细介绍如何轻松构建适配各类设备的互动表单。
了解跨平台表单设计的重要性
首先,我们需要明确跨平台表单设计的重要性。随着智能手机、平板电脑、笔记本电脑等设备的普及,用户可能在不同的设备上访问你的网站或应用程序。如果表单在不同设备上表现不一致,可能会导致用户流失。因此,跨平台表单设计至关重要。
选择合适的表单构建工具
市面上有很多表单构建工具,如Wufoo、JotForm、Typeform等。这些工具提供了丰富的模板和功能,可以帮助你快速构建表单。在选择工具时,请考虑以下因素:
- 易用性:选择一个易于使用、学习曲线较平缓的工具。
- 功能丰富:确保工具提供了你需要的所有功能,如表单字段、验证、集成等。
- 定制性:选择一个允许你自定义表单外观和行为的工具。
设计原则
以下是一些设计跨平台表单时需要遵循的原则:
1. 简洁明了
确保表单设计简洁明了,避免过多的选项和字段。用户应该能够快速填写并提交表单。
2. 适应性
使用响应式设计,确保表单在不同设备上都能良好显示。例如,使用百分比宽度而非固定宽度,以及媒体查询来调整布局。
3. 一致性
在所有设备上保持一致的用户体验。这意味着表单字段、按钮和导航元素应该看起来和感觉一样。
4. 输入验证
提供实时输入验证,帮助用户纠正错误。例如,使用JavaScript验证电子邮件地址格式。
5. 优化加载速度
确保表单加载速度快,尤其是在移动设备上。优化图片和脚本,减少HTTP请求。
实践案例
以下是一个简单的表单设计案例,用于收集用户的基本信息:
<form action="/submit-form" method="post">
<label for="name">姓名:</label>
<input type="text" id="name" name="name" required>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<label for="message">留言:</label>
<textarea id="message" name="message" rows="4" required></textarea>
<button type="submit">提交</button>
</form>
总结
跨平台表单设计是一个复杂的过程,但通过遵循上述原则和案例,你可以轻松构建适配各类设备的互动表单。记住,始终关注用户体验,确保表单既美观又实用。
